Principal Electrical Consulting Engineer – GHD, Greater Guildford Area, United Kingdom.
We are seeking a Principal Electrical Consulting Engineer to join our UK Power team and provide technical leadership on transformative projects across the UK, Europe, the Middle East and Australia. This is an opportunity to be part of a global, employee-owned business where your expertise will help clients navigate the energy transition and shape the next generation of engineering talent.
Responsibilities
 * Acting as technical lead on major power system projects (transmission, distribution and generation).
 * Leading the design, specification and integration of high-voltage systems, including substations, cable systems, transformers, switchgear, and reactive compensation equipment.
 * Delivering FEED and conceptual studies, technical due diligence and serving as Owner’s Engineer.
 * Providing expert input into power system protection, equipment specification, and system performance assessments.
 * Supporting factory acceptance testing (FAT), site acceptance testing (SAT), commissioning, and construction support.
 * Building strong client relationships, identifying new opportunities and contributing to business development and tendering activities.
 * Mentoring and developing junior engineers, sharing knowledge across UK and international teams.
What You’ll Bring: Skills & Experience
 * Degree in Electrical Engineering (BEng/BSc minimum; MEng/MSc desirable).
 * 10+ years’ experience in power systems engineering within transmission, distribution, or generation projects.
 * Broad understanding of the UK electricity sector, regulatory frameworks, and stakeholder landscape.
 * In-depth technical expertise in at least one of the following:
 o High-voltage plant and equipment (switchgear, transformers, harmonic filters, dynamic reactive compensation)
 o Power cable system design and specification
 o Power system protection and control
 * Experience with design, specification, construction, operation and maintenance of HV electrical infrastructure.
 * Previous exposure to consulting or client-facing roles, with the ability to deliver advice that is both technically rigorous and commercially grounded.
 * Experience with FAT, SAT, commissioning and on-site works (desirable).
 * Chartered Engineer status (CEng) or working towards with a relevant institution (e.g. IET).
